Nutrient Retention

Preserving the nutritional content of fruits and vegetables is a key advantage of slow juicing technology. By operating at a reduced speed, advanced juicers minimise heat generation, which helps to protect delicate vitamins and enzymes that may otherwise degrade during high-speed processing. This gentle method also limits the oxidation process, ensuring that the juice retains its natural composition for longer periods.

Frequently Asked Questions

What is the primary difference between a twin-gear juicer and a centrifugal juicer?

The main distinction lies in the extraction speed and the physical method of breaking down produce. A centrifugal juicer uses a high-speed spinning blade to shred fruits and vegetables, which introduces significant heat and oxygen, leading to rapid nutrient degradation and foaming. In contrast, a twin-gear machine like the Angel 5500 operates at a much lower speed, typically around 82 RPM, using two interlocking stainless steel gears to crush and grind the produce. This "cold press" method preserves delicate enzymes and vitamins, producing a much higher juice yield and a far drier pulp, which is particularly noticeable when processing expensive Australian organic leafy greens or wheatgrass.

Why is surgical-grade stainless steel important for a juicer’s construction?

Surgical-grade stainless steel is highly prized in the Australian juicing community because it is completely non-reactive and highly resistant to the corrosive acids found in citrus and many vegetables. Unlike plastic components, which can leach bisphenols or become stained and brittle over time, stainless steel remains inert and hygienic throughout decades of use. This material choice also ensures that the high pressure required for "complete" extraction does not warp or damage the internal housing. Furthermore, the smooth, non-porous surface of stainless steel prevents the buildup of bacteria and odours, ensuring that every glass of juice tastes as fresh as the produce it was made from.

How long can I store juice made from a slow-extraction machine?

Juice extracted via a slow-press twin-gear mechanism has a significantly longer shelf life than juice from high-speed machines. Because the low-speed process introduces minimal oxygen into the liquid, the oxidation process is delayed. In an Australian household, this means you can typically store your fresh juice in an airtight glass container in the refrigerator for up to 72 hours without a significant loss in nutritional value or flavour. This is a major convenience for busy professionals or families, as it allows for "batch juicing" a few times a week rather than having to clean the machine after every single glass.

Can an advanced Super Angel Pro Stainless Steel Juicer process tough ingredients like ginger or turmeric?

Yes, high-performance twin-gear extractors are specifically designed to handle the toughest fibrous ingredients that would often stall or damage a standard domestic super angel pro stainless steel juicer. The powerful torque generated by the motor and the precision-engineered gears can easily grind through woody ginger roots, hard turmeric, and even soaked nuts for making homemade almond or soy milk. This versatility allows Australian users to create potent wellness shots and complex culinary bases. Because the gears effectively "chew" the produce, the extraction of deep-seated nutrients from these dense roots is far more thorough, ensuring you get the maximum therapeutic benefit from your ingredients.

What is the best way to clean and maintain a premium stainless steel juicer?

Cleaning a premium juicer is most efficient when done immediately after use before the natural sugars and fibres have a chance to dry and harden. Most Australian users find that a quick rinse under warm running water, combined with a firm scrub using the supplied specialised brushes, is sufficient for daily maintenance. Periodically, the stainless steel screens may require a deeper soak in a solution of citric acid or a mild detergent to remove mineral buildup from hard water or stubborn vegetable pigments. Because the components are precision-machined, they fit together seamlessly, making the assembly and disassembly process a simple, thirty-second task once you become familiar with the device.
